8815 Broadmoor Drive

LOCATION:

Omaha, Nebraska


DESCRIPTION:

A typical 1950 ranch-style home was reimagined through a thoughtful renovation and addition that responds to modern living patterns while establishing a new definition and era for the home. The original structure was maintained and updated, while a second-story addition and relocated stairway introduced additional square footage, bedrooms, and bathrooms to the original two-bedroom, one-bath home.

Taking cues from mid-century design principles, the reconfigured layout creates open, flexible spaces for entertaining, working, dining, relaxing, and retreating. Rather than mimic the existing architecture, the new addition provides intentional contrast, creating a dialogue between old and new. Through materiality, proportion, and cohesive connections between spaces, the renovation balances the character of the original home with the needs of contemporary living.
